Lab Matters – Are we up to a brighter future?

Many security technologies rely on denylisting malicious or suspicious files or applications in order to prevent users from running them. But that approach can have its limitations, and theidea of allowlisting applications and safe files has taken hold recently. In this video, Vladimir Zapolyansky talks about the benefits of application allowlisting, the way that the technology works and how it can help users protect their PCs more effectively.
